// SCANNER_POLL_INTERVAL_MS — how often the Brambletap bridge polls the
// barcode scanner for buffered reads. Plugin authors: don't go below
// 50ms, the cheap handheld units choke and start double-firing scans.
// If your plugin needs faster feedback, hook the onScan event instead
// of tightening this loop. Compatibility quirks per device are listed
// in the Wrenfold plugin docs. When filing a report, attach the bridge
// token printed just below.

trace token, fafog-kageg: htk4_98e6

Heads up for whoever touches Datewright next: the CI failures on the l10n suite are almost always locale data drift, not your code. The Finch runners ship an older ICU bundle than prod, so short-month formats for a few locales come out wrong and the snapshot tests explode. Quick fix: bump the locale fixture image in the pipeline config and re-run. Don't hand-edit snapshots. For reference, the last known-good run carries this token.

session token of bawep-yadup = htk21_528abd376e3c5a4ec24a1

## 3.2.0 — Changed defaults

Shrinkray, our batch image resizing CLI, ships new defaults in this release. Output format now defaults to lossless webp, worker count is auto-detected instead of fixed at 4, and overwrite protection is on by default. If you have scripts relying on the old behavior, pass the flags explicitly. For reference, the full set of defaults the binary now bakes in is listed below.

deployment values, bagag-bawig:
DRUVAN_PIN=0740
DRUVAN_TENANT=wendor
DRUVAN_METRICS_HOST=metrics.druvan.tolvaqnet.example
DRUVAN_SEAL=seal_75cd0b2d
DRUVAN_STANDBY_TEAM=tamael

# Pooling config for the Tidehollow support replica.
# POOL_MIN and POOL_MAX bound the connection pool; keep POOL_MAX under 40
# or the replica starts refusing new sessions during ticket-volume spikes.
# POOL_IDLE_TIMEOUT_MS reclaims idle connections — 30000 is the tested default.
# If support tooling shows "pool exhausted" errors, check these before escalating.
# The database credential the pool uses goes on the very next line.

sealed setting: ARCHIVE_KEY3=8d0